Crews Plug Levee Break a Week After Storm view story
Tuesday, September 6, 2005
AP's Doug Simpson - - Austin American-Statesman
| A week after Hurricane Katrina, engineers plugged the levee break that swamped much of the city and floodwaters began to recede, but along with the good news came the mayor's direst prediction yet: As many as 10,000 dead.
